Concord v4 Phone Failure
Okay so I am adding a phone number for my central station and I ran a line to the panel and something keeps interrupting my signals. All I receive is front door open at central station but not the other sensors and when I use my butt set I can hear it being interrupted. Phone company came and went saying basically they trouble shot their phone system, but it's still the same problem for me. I tried different new panels and swapped everything and yet the line is still interrupted.... any ideas ????

No location in your profile so I don't know whether or not you're in North America.
1. Do you have a Voice Over IP phone line? Few communicators work well with VOIP (if they work at all).
2. Do you have a DSL? (Digital Subscriber Line with internet service through your regular phone line? It's also known as Data Over Voice or Data Under Voice. If you do you need a DSL Filter for Alarm COmmunicators.)
3. Is the RJ31X wired correctly? (In other words do you have full line seizure. One way to test is to remove the RED and GREEN telephone lines from the panel and then call your landline from a cell phone. If you hear a phone ringing, you don't have full line seizure. DON'T FORGET TO RECONNECT Red AND Green AT THE ALARM PANEL.

Assuming you haven't done something like land the wires on the RJ31x jack backward (so that the system essentially hangs up on itself when it tries to go off hook); do you have call waiting on your phone line? The little click/beep you hear with incoming calls is interpreted by most dialers as a signal to hang up.
